Fit is fine. I just weld from the centre out which is essentially a vertical up weld with the electrode pointing down. On the next one i will try welding from the outside into the middle, which would mean that weld direction is the same as electrode direction.
No mitre setup, just paper templates printed out of the computer. Cut along lines with angle grinder and dress up with linisher.
Material is ASTM A106-B seamless pipe.

Commotion, nice welding. Can you give us more information/instruction on these paper templates? What program are you using to flatten the pipes?
I just draft it up in solidwork. Get the layout i want, pipe size, merge angle, flange size etc. Trim the individual pipes then slit them and unfold them like a sheet metal part.
